In Loving Memory of Bruce Mackinnon

Bruce Albert James

Born January 15, 1957 in Brantford, Ontario passed away March 1, 2003 in Langley, B.C., with his family by his side following a courageous battle with cancer. Despite this he always had a smile on his face, a twinkle in his eye and joke or witty comment to share with all.

Bruce will be forever lovingly remembered by his wife, Elsie; daughters, Angela and Heather; Mother, Norma Bourne (Frank), brother Ron (Deb); and sisters Janice (Ed) and Susan (Rory) as well as numerous nieces and nephews, many relatives, friends, business associates and employees.

Bruce was an extremely devoted, loving and caring husband and father and found joy in his life playing golf and hockey, fishing, playing the bagpipes, and spending time around family and friends.

Bruce attended Point Grey High School in Vancouver and began his career with Domtar in 1975, which led to various positions in Kamloops, Kelowna and Victoria. In 1993 he began working for Hub City Supplies (the Winroc Corp.) in Courtenay and Nanaimo and in 2001 moved to Langley and became General Manager for the Lower Mainland. He was very dedicated and hardworking and loved new challenges.

Everyone who knew Bruce was touched by his love, kindness and unique sense of humour. Although Bruce has left us for now, we each have special memories of him that will keep him alive in our hearts forever.
